> It seems to me that, abstractly, observers should not be allowed to
> throw exceptions. Perhaps the observer machinery itself ought to catch
> them. My reasoning is that letting an observer throw an exception will
> make the observer mechanism apparently unreliable: a given observer
> might or might not be called, depending on whether some earlier observer
> encountered an error.
I think this makes sense.
